将Mongo从本地部署到服务器是指将MongoDB数据库从本地计算机迁移到云服务器上运行。下面是一个完善且全面的答案:
MongoDB是一种开源的文档型NoSQL数据库,具有高性能、可扩展性和灵活性的特点。将Mongo从本地部署到服务器可以提供更好的数据存储和访问性能,同时还可以实现数据的备份和容灾。
以下是将Mongo从本地部署到服务器的步骤:
- 选择云服务器:根据实际需求选择适合的云服务器,可以考虑腾讯云的云服务器CVM。腾讯云的云服务器提供了多种规格和配置选项,可以根据实际需求选择合适的服务器。
- 安装MongoDB:在云服务器上安装MongoDB数据库。可以通过腾讯云的云服务器控制台登录服务器,然后按照MongoDB官方文档提供的安装步骤进行安装。
- 配置MongoDB:在云服务器上配置MongoDB数据库。可以通过编辑MongoDB的配置文件来设置数据库的参数,例如监听的IP地址、端口号、认证方式等。
- 导入数据:将本地MongoDB数据库中的数据导出,并在云服务器上导入数据。可以使用MongoDB提供的工具,如mongodump和mongorestore,来完成数据的导入和导出。
- 连接MongoDB:在本地开发环境或其他应用程序中修改MongoDB连接配置,将连接地址指向云服务器上的MongoDB数据库。可以使用腾讯云提供的私有网络或公网IP来进行连接。
- 测试和优化:在云服务器上进行测试和优化,确保MongoDB数据库在云环境下的性能和稳定性。可以使用腾讯云的云监控和云审计等服务来监控和管理MongoDB数据库。
推荐的腾讯云相关产品:
- 云服务器CVM:提供高性能、可扩展的云服务器实例,支持多种操作系统和应用场景。详情请参考:腾讯云云服务器
- 云数据库MongoDB:提供稳定可靠的MongoDB数据库服务,支持自动备份、容灾和性能优化。详情请参考:腾讯云云数据库MongoDB
通过以上步骤,您可以将MongoDB从本地部署到腾讯云的云服务器上,实现高性能、可靠的数据库服务。